Supplies
- Frame (3D Design in Onshape) (x1)
- Standoffs (x8)
- Joysticks (x2)
- Breadboard-mounted circuitry (x1)
Add Standoffs to the Frame
Install M3-6 standoffs on both sides of the frame where the joysticks will be mounted. There should be four on each side.
Attach the Joysticks
Using M3 screws, attach the left and right Joysticks to the standoffs, with the Joystick pins downward as shown. (The right side of the Joystick Controller is next to the battery pack holder.)
Attach the Breadboard
Firmly push the breadboards holding the circuitry into the slot provided for them on the frame. The breadboards should fit snugly.
Add Battery Holder
Firmly press the Battery Holder into the slot provided for it on the frame. It should fit snugly.
Connect the Battery
Connect the battery leads to the Pico VSYS and GND pins.
Connect the Joysticks
Using Dupont male-to-female jumpers, connect the Joystick pins to the appropriate Pico pins.
